Crystal Palace boss Warnock hoping for new striker

Crystal Palace manager Neil Warnock is hopeful of luring a new striker to the club in the January transfer window.

The Eagles boss may lose young forward Feddie Sears to West Ham in January as the Premier League club may call him back from a spell at Selhurst Park and Warnock hopes to replace him if that happens.

"I don't think it's 100 per cent that no-one will be coming in during the transfer window," he told the Croydon Advertiser.

"I'm still looking around for another striker. If I get a few of the fringe players out on loan then I think I can talk Simon Jordan into it.

"It's pretty clear that we could do with someone who can find the net on a regular basis."
